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
499901 6528468 90014872942
47469686 907
47469686 907
618 0256686836 89849844339 5004366129
All about undefined
Interested in learning more?
47469686 907
618 0256686836 89849844339 5004366129
See more
7028778064 0544
890419 869569816 41
See more
535294 35600955 2804
5242807294 797 49
See more